  1. Meditation

Anxiety is characterized by our thought patterns spiraling out of control and creating a sense of helplessness. To rein in your thoughts and bring calm to yourself both mentally and physically, consider exploring meditation.

Meditation techniques such as “mindfulness meditation” asks that practitioners spend a certain amount of time each day focusing on their breath and nothing else. This forced slowing of your mind, even for a few minutes, can help bring you more peace throughout your day.

  1. Bringing Pragmatism to Your Thought Pattern

Being pragmatic about the thoughts that you’re experiencing can help you retain your rational mind during an anxiety attack. For example, if your partner didn’t say goodbye to you this morning before leaving to work and that oversight creates anxiety for you, consider rational reasons for your partner’s oversight.

For example, is it more likely that your partner was running late to work and forgot to say goodbye or that there’s a broad problem with your relationship?

By considering pragmatic reasons for your everyday issues, you can help keep yourself from getting caught up in negative thought patterns.

  1. Keeping Busy

The less time that your mind has to ruminate, the less chance that it will have to become anxious.

Find hobbies. Hang out with friends. Tackle new projects at work.

Anything that you can do to keep your brain focused on being productive will help you move further away from your life with anxiety and towards a more positive existence.
